Comprehending Typical Home Appliance Concerns



When your appliances begin breaking down, it can really feel frustrating, especially if you're uncertain what the trouble is. Usual problems commonly develop with fridges, washers, and dryers, and knowing what to search for can conserve you time and stress and anxiety. If your fridge isn't cooling down, examine the temperature setups or listen for uncommon audios that might show a stopping working compressor.With washing devices, leakages normally stem from used hoses or damaged door seals. If your dryer isn't heating, a blocked vent may be the perpetrator.

Source Of Power Measures



Guaranteeing that a home appliance is disconnected from its source of power is crucial for your safety and security during repair work (Washer dryer repair service Dependable Refrigeration). Prior to you begin, disconnect the home appliance or shut off the circuit breaker. This simple action protects against electrical shocks or mishaps. Constantly double-check that the power is off using a voltage tester-- do not count on assumptions! If you're dealing with bigger appliances, think about utilizing a lockout/tagout system to avoid unintentional reactivation. Maintain your workplace dry and free from mess to lessen risks. Put on shielded gloves and use tools with rubber holds to supply extra protection. Never effort repairs in damp conditions, as water and electrical energy don't mix. By adhering to these precautions, you'll produce a safer setting for your do it yourself repair job

Preserving Your Appliances for Durability



To guarantee your home appliances offer you well for years to find, normal maintenance is vital. Beginning by cleaning your devices regularly; dust and particles can develop up and prevent efficiency. For refrigerators, inspect the door seals and clean the coils to keep them reliable. Wash your washing device's drum and dispensers to avoid mold and odors.Don' t fail to remember to check hoses and connections for leaks or put on. For dishwashers, run a cleansing cycle month-to-month to verify appropriate water drainage and eliminate odors.Keep an eye on any uncommon sounds or performance issues-- resolving these early can prevent costly repairs down the line (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service Dryer repair near me). Lastly, refer to your appliance manuals for specific upkeep pointers and advised service intervals. By adopting these techniques, you'll not just expand the life of your home appliances but likewise enhance their efficiency, conserving you time and cash in the long run
